HUMAN RIGHTS COMMISSION <br /> Minutes for January 18th 1994 <br /> Commissioners present were: Dave Bowers, Gwen Willems, John Treadwell. <br /> Commissioners absent were: Ed Sheppard <br /> Guests present were: Sue Gehrz and Wayne Groff. <br /> WELCOME TO SUE GEHRZ AS OUR NEW COUNCIL LIAISON!!! <br /> Minutes for the December 22nd meeting were not available for approval. <br /> The Meeting was call -to -order at 7:OOPM <br /> Business: <br /> 1. Election of a new chairperson was proposed. Gwen nominated Dave Bowers and <br /> JohnTreadwell seconded the nomination. All members voted to elect Dave Bowers as the <br /> chairperson and he accepted the nomination. <br /> 2. Discussion on the brochure for the HRC was briefly discussed. Gwen and Dave had <br /> met to brainstorm, some possible issues that they would like to see in the brochure. Any <br /> comments or other ideas are welcomed from the other commissioners. The distribution of <br /> the brochure was discussed. Ideas were: send with the newsletter, direct mailing to the <br /> public, availability at City Hall,.and distribution at local businesses. <br /> 3. HRC budget was discussed. Dave with check with Susan Hoyt as to the amount <br /> available to the Commission and possible additional funds for training and conference <br /> costs. <br /> 4. Gwen would like to attend the International Conference in Canada and would like <br /> support from our HRC in the form of verbal and monetary support. Gwen would like to <br /> know the dollar amount that our commission will fund for this conference, so that she can <br /> get future monetary support from the State Commission. The cost would be approximately <br /> 670.00. <br /> 5. Discussion on whether continuing mediation training for members of the HRC was cost <br /> effective or, whether the City could hire an outside mediation service to handle the cases <br /> that may present themselves. <br /> 6. Discussion on changing the name of the current Human Rights Commission to another <br /> name that may reflect more diversity such as, Human Resource Commission. Future <br /> views on this topic are welcomed by all members. <br /> 7. Sue Gehrz spoke briefly on the directions the City Council is taking to enchance <br /> community involvement,to give a sense of belonging to everyone in the community. <br /> Particularly, involvement and interaction between all age groups. There has been and there <br /> is a continuing effort of the community to develop positive activities for youths who may <br /> not be mainstream, to better involve them with the community. <br /> 8. Brief discussion of involvement jointly of our commission with the other surrounding <br /> communities commissions. <br />
